  • alluaivite's chemical formula is recorded as Na₁₉(Ca,Mn²⁺)₆(Ti,Nb)₃Si₂₆O₇₄Cl·2H₂O[5].
  • alluaivite is a type of eudialyte mineral group[6].
  • alluaivite's streak color is recorded as white[7].
  • alluaivite's crystal system is recorded as trigonal crystal system[8].
  • alluaivite's IMA status and/or rank is recorded as approved mineral and/or valid name (A)[9].
  • alluaivite's space group is recorded as space group R-3m[10].
  • alluaivite's Nickel-Strunz 9th edition is recorded as 9.CO.10[11].
  • alluaivite's Nickel-Strunz '10th ed', review of is recorded as 9.CO.10[12].
  • alluaivite's described by source is recorded as Alluaivite Na19(Ca,Mn)6(Ti,Nb)3Si26O74Cl·2H2O – a new titanosilicate of eudialyte–like structure[13].
  • alluaivite's type locality is recorded as Alluaiv Mountain[14].
  • alluaivite's IMA Mineral Symbol is recorded as Aav[15].
